■ Liberalism and nationalism became associated with revolution in many regions of Europe such as the Italian and
German states, the provinces of the Ottoman Empire, Ireland and Poland.
■ The first upheaval took place in France, in July 1830.
■ The Greek War of Independence was another event which mobilised nationalist feelings among the educated elite in Europe.
■ Culture played an important role in creating the idea of the nation. Art and poetry, stories, music helped to express and shape nationalist feelings.
■ Romanticism was a cultural movement which sought to develop a particular form of nationalist sentiment.
■ Language too played an important role in developing nationalist sentiments.
■ The 1830s saw a rise in prices, bad harvest, poverty in Europe. Besides the poor, unemployed and starving peasants, even educated middle classes, revolted.
■ In 1848, a large number of political associations came together in Frankfurt and decided to vote for an all-German National Assembly.
■ The issue of extending political rights to women became a controversial one.
■ Conservative forces were able to suppress liberal movements in 1848, but could not restore the old order.
■ After 1848, nationalism in Europe moved away from its association with democracy and revolution.
